The Global Retinal Vein Occlusion (RVO) Treatment Market is projected to experience robust growth, escalating from USD 3.13 billion in 2025 to USD 4.68 billion by 2031, at a compound annual growth rate of 6.93%. This market primarily encompasses pharmacotherapies, notably anti-vascular endothelial growth factor (anti-VEGF) agents and corticosteroid implants, designed to mitigate macular edema and enhance visual acuity in patients afflicted by thrombotic retinal blockages. The market's expansion is fundamentally propelled by a globally aging population and the increasing prevalence of lifestyle-related risk factors such as hypertension, diabetes mellitus, and cardiovascular disorders, all of which significantly elevate the incidence of retinal vascular events. These systemic health issues compromise retinal vascular integrity, thereby increasing the patient pool susceptible to such events and consequently driving demand for effective pharmacotherapies to manage vision-threatening complications; this is evident in the strong financial performance of leading therapeutics like Eylea HD, which saw significant sales increases following its RVO approval. Additionally, the widespread adoption of advanced anti-VEGF and corticosteroid therapeutics, coupled with a robust pipeline of novel biosimilars, is reshaping market dynamics by addressing the critical need for reduced treatment burden through extended durability, which minimizes the frequency of invasive intravitreal injections and improves long-term compliance, as demonstrated by the rapid uptake of high-strength formulations and the aggressive expansion of innovative retinal therapies such as Vabysmo.

Market Driver

The escalating prevalence of lifestyle-related comorbidities, particularly diabetes and hypertension, alongside an expanding global geriatric population, stands as a primary catalyst for the retinal vein occlusion treatment market. These systemic health issues significantly compromise retinal vascular integrity, leading to a higher incidence of thrombotic events that necessitate therapeutic intervention. As the patient pool susceptible to these vascular disorders grows, there is a consequential rise in the demand for effective pharmacotherapies to manage vision-threatening complications like macular edema. This surge in clinical demand is reflected in the financial performance of leading therapeutics; according to Regeneron Pharmaceuticals, October 2025, in the 'Third Quarter 2025 Financial and Operating Results', U.S. net sales of Eylea HD increased 10% to $431 million, driven by higher sales volumes and rising demand following its approval for retinal vein occlusion. Simultaneously, the widespread adoption of advanced anti-VEGF and corticosteroid therapeutics, coupled with a robust pipeline of novel biosimilars, is reshaping market dynamics by addressing the critical need for reduced treatment burden. Clinicians and patients are increasingly prioritizing next-generation agents that offer extended durability, thereby reducing the frequency of invasive intravitreal injections and improving long-term compliance. This transition toward higher-efficacy treatments is evident in product uptake data; according to Bayer, November 2025, in the 'Third Quarter 2025 Financial Report', the new high-strength formulation of aflibercept has rapidly gained traction, now accounting for more than a quarter of the product's total sales mix. This competitive shift is further underscored by the broader market momentum, where according to Roche, July 2025, sales of the bispecific antibody Vabysmo surged 18% to CHF 2.1 billion in the first half of the year, highlighting the aggressive expansion of the innovative retinal therapy segment.

Market Challenge

However, the market's growth faces a significant impediment due to the substantial treatment burden inherent in chronic anti-VEGF therapy. While these pharmacotherapies offer functional improvements, the necessity for frequent intravitreal injections creates considerable logistical and psychological strain on patients, leading to injection fatigue, non-compliance, and, ultimately, treatment discontinuation. This rigorous regimen, often requiring monthly or bimonthly clinical visits, disrupts daily life and incurs significant indirect costs for caregivers, effectively acting as a ceiling on market volume and eroding potential revenue. The severity of this attrition is highlighted by reports that 63% of surveyed specialists experienced patient loss to follow-up in 2025 due to treatment access and burden challenges. Such high rates of drop-out demonstrate how non-compliance, driven by the demanding nature of current delivery methods, directly erodes the addressable market size.

Market Trends

In response, the Global RVO Treatment Market is undergoing a pivotal transformation marked by a shift toward extended-duration anti-VEGF dosing regimens, focusing on developing novel antibody biopolymer conjugates designed to maintain therapeutic intraocular concentrations for much longer periods, thereby enabling biannual dosing without compromising visual gains, as exemplified by positive data from studies on agents like tarcocimab tedromer. Concurrently, the market penetration of cost-effective anti-VEGF biosimilars is fundamentally reshaping the economic landscape of retinal care by dismantling the pricing monopoly of branded biologics. As patents for legacy anti-VEGF agents expire, healthcare systems are aggressively integrating interchangeable biosimilars to manage escalating costs, with strong commercial volume reflecting a robust acceptance of these fiscally sustainable and clinically equivalent alternatives in practice.
